发布者:售前霍霍 | 本文章发表于:2024-12-01 阅读数:990
在服务器运维过程中,CPU使用率过高是一个常见且需要及时解决的问题。高CPU使用率不仅会影响服务器的性能和稳定性,还可能导致服务中断或数据丢失。
CPU跑高的影响
高CPU使用率对服务器的影响主要体现在以下几个方面:
性能下降:CPU是服务器的核心处理单元,其性能直接影响服务器的整体性能。当CPU使用率过高时,服务器的响应时间会变长,处理能力会下降。
稳定性受损:长期高CPU使用率可能导致服务器崩溃或重启,严重影响服务的稳定性和可用性。
能耗增加:CPU在高负载下会消耗更多的电能,导致服务器能耗增加,运营成本上升。
针对服务器CPU跑高的问题,我们可以采取以下优化策略:
查找并终止异常进程:使用系统监控工具(如top、htop等)查找占用CPU资源最多的进程,并分析其是否为正常业务进程。若发现异常进程,可尝试终止该进程或重启服务。
优化系统配置:调整系统配置,如增加CPU分配策略、优化内存管理等,以提高服务器的资源利用率和性能。
负载均衡:通过负载均衡技术,将请求分散到多台服务器上,降低单台服务器的负载压力。
服务器CPU跑高是一个需要引起高度重视的问题。通过识别原因、分析影响并采取有效的优化策略,我们可以有效地降低CPU使用率,提高服务器的性能和稳定性。在未来的运维工作中,我们应持续关注服务器的性能指标,及时发现并解决问题,确保服务的顺畅运行。
下一篇
网络安全必备:如何发现和修复互联网漏洞?
随着互联网技术的不断发展和普及,网络安全问题已经成为大家关注的焦点。因为网络泄露、黑客攻击、恶意软件等问题,很多人和企业都遭受了损失。想要保护自己的网络安全,关键在于发现和修复互联网漏洞。那么,本文将带大家详细了解网络安全必备:如何发现和修复互联网漏洞?一、什么是互联网漏洞?互联网漏洞是指在互联网上存在的安全缺陷,是黑客攻击网站或者系统的“门户”。这些漏洞可能来自于操作系统、应用程序、网站设计、用户密码等多个方面。一旦黑客利用漏洞入侵了系统,他们就可以获取敏感数据、日志、密码、金融信息,甚至破坏或篡改系统。二、如何发现互联网漏洞?漏洞扫描工具漏洞扫描工具是自动化的软件,用于识别系统中的安全漏洞。扫描工具可以立即检索网络服务的任何已知漏洞,并报告它们的位置和详细信息。可用的扫描技术包括不断增加的端口扫描、服务扫描、弱口令扫描、漏洞扫描等。一般使用漏洞扫描工具的流程如下:(1)扫描设备IP。(2)端口扫描。(3)服务检测。(4)弱口令检测。(5)漏洞检测和扫描。漏洞挖掘技术漏洞挖掘是一种人工发现漏洞的方法,是白帽子常用的技术。挖掘漏洞的方法是在目标系统上进行手动测试,总结出攻击的漏洞情况。漏洞挖掘的流程如下:(1)了解目标系统。(2)系统扫描和收集。(3)弱口令检测。(4)手动挖掘漏洞。三、如何修复互联网漏洞?及时升级补丁常见网络攻击手段就是利用网络系统和软件的漏洞。因此及时升级系统和软件的安全补丁是很重要的。升级补丁可以修复已知的漏洞,提高系统和应用程序的安全。保证与网络处于同一级别的所有设备在维护方面都是最新的。通过安装补丁和更新安全文件夹,可以保障系统的安全。强化密码保护强密码可以减少对黑客攻击的风险。密码使用应遵循以下原则:(1)密码复杂性:应包含数字、字母大小写和特殊字符。(2)密码长度:长度应达到8个或更多字符。(3)差异性:不同的网站和应用使用不同的密码。(4)定期更改密码:密码应定期更改。定期备份数据定期备份数据不仅可以防止数据损失,还可以帮助我们及时修复互联网漏洞。当我们发现安全漏洞和攻击已经发生时,备份的数据可以在短时间内恢复到正常的状态,避免有重要数据丢失。恢复系统默认设置为了避免网络漏洞,拥有网络和系统的管理员应该恢复系统的默认设置。整个操作应该包括:(1)检查系统文件和组件,找出问题和修复错误。(2)检查安装的应用程序和所有组件,并根据版本和代码来升级软件。(3)安装本地防火墙和杀毒软件,以确保始终保持安全。四、重视互联网漏洞防范需要我们采取多种手段,除了上文提到的方法外,我们还可以通过安全升级、数据加密和访问权限等方式加强网络安全。建立合理的安全机制和安全意识,保护自己的互联网安全是我们必须重视的任务。
虚拟化技术是什么?
虚拟化技术是一种资源管理技术,它将计算机的各种实体资源,如服务器、网络、内存及存储等,予以抽象、转换后呈现出来,并可供分割、组合为一个或多个电脑配置环境。虚拟化技术可以模拟真正的(或者称物理的)计算机资源,从而打破实体结构间的不可切割的障碍,使用户可以比原本的组态更好的方式来应用这些资源。这些资源的新虚拟部分是不受现有资源的架设方式、地域或物理组态所限制。 虚拟化技术的分类主要包括网络虚拟化和存储虚拟化。网络虚拟化将网络资源进行整合,将硬件与软件的网络设备资源,以及网络功能整合为一个统一的、基于软件可管理的虚拟网络。存储虚拟化则整合所有存储资源为一个存储池,对外提供逻辑存储接口,用户通过逻辑接口进行数据的读写,不论有多少个硬件存储设备,对外看到的只有一个。 虚拟化技术的主要优势在于提高计算机的工作效率,解决高性能的物理硬件产能过剩和老的旧的硬件产能过低的重组重用问题,并最大化地利用物理硬件。虚拟化技术已经成为私有云和混合云设计方案的基础,通过虚拟机(Virtual Machine, VM)技术,可以在一台计算机上同时运行多个逻辑计算机,每个逻辑计算机可运行不同的操作系统,并且应用程序都可以在相互独立的空间内运行而互不影响。 总的来说,虚拟化技术是一种重要的计算机技术,它可以提高计算机的工作效率,优化硬件资源的利用,为云计算和大数据等技术的发展提供了重要的支持。
负载均衡是什么?
均衡负载(Load Balancing)是一种集群技术,主要用于在多个计算机(计算机集群)、网络连接、CPU、磁盘驱动器或其他资源中分配负载,以达到最优化资源使用、最大化吞吐率、最小化响应时间、同时避免过载的目的。 均衡负载的核心思想是将负载(工作任务)进行平衡、分摊到多个操作单元上进行运行,如Web服务器、FTP服务器、企业核心应用服务器和其他主要任务服务器等,从而协同完成工作任务。它建立在现有网络结构之上,提供了一种廉价有效透明的方法扩展服务器和网络设备的带宽、加强网络数据处理能力、增加吞吐量、提高网络的可用性和灵活性。 均衡负载的原理是通过运行在前面的负载均衡服务,按照指定的负载均衡算法,将流量分配到后端服务集群上,从而为系统提供并行扩展的能力。这种技术允许将大量并发访问或数据流量分担到多台节点设备上分别处理,减少用户等待响应的时间;同时,单个重负载的运算可以分担到多台节点设备上做并行处理,每个节点设备处理结束后,将结果汇总,返回给用户,系统处理能力得到大幅度提高。 常见的负载均衡算法包括轮询法(Round Robin, RR)、加权轮询法(Weighted Round Robin, WRR)、源地址散列法(Source Hash)、最小连接数法(Least Connections)等。每种算法都有其特定的适用场景和优缺点。 均衡负载是现代计算机系统中不可或缺的一部分,它通过对负载的合理分配,实现了系统资源的最大化利用,提高了系统的可靠性、可用性和扩展性。
阅读数:9213 | 2023-07-28 16:38:52
阅读数:5886 | 2022-12-09 10:20:54
阅读数:4680 | 2023-02-24 16:17:19
阅读数:4657 | 2024-06-01 00:00:00
阅读数:4489 | 2023-08-07 00:00:00
阅读数:4193 | 2022-06-10 09:57:57
阅读数:4081 | 2023-07-24 00:00:00
阅读数:4057 | 2021-12-10 10:50:19
阅读数:9213 | 2023-07-28 16:38:52
阅读数:5886 | 2022-12-09 10:20:54
阅读数:4680 | 2023-02-24 16:17:19
阅读数:4657 | 2024-06-01 00:00:00
阅读数:4489 | 2023-08-07 00:00:00
阅读数:4193 | 2022-06-10 09:57:57
阅读数:4081 | 2023-07-24 00:00:00
阅读数:4057 | 2021-12-10 10:50:19
发布者:售前霍霍 | 本文章发表于:2024-12-01
在服务器运维过程中,CPU使用率过高是一个常见且需要及时解决的问题。高CPU使用率不仅会影响服务器的性能和稳定性,还可能导致服务中断或数据丢失。
CPU跑高的影响
高CPU使用率对服务器的影响主要体现在以下几个方面:
性能下降:CPU是服务器的核心处理单元,其性能直接影响服务器的整体性能。当CPU使用率过高时,服务器的响应时间会变长,处理能力会下降。
稳定性受损:长期高CPU使用率可能导致服务器崩溃或重启,严重影响服务的稳定性和可用性。
能耗增加:CPU在高负载下会消耗更多的电能,导致服务器能耗增加,运营成本上升。
针对服务器CPU跑高的问题,我们可以采取以下优化策略:
查找并终止异常进程:使用系统监控工具(如top、htop等)查找占用CPU资源最多的进程,并分析其是否为正常业务进程。若发现异常进程,可尝试终止该进程或重启服务。
优化系统配置:调整系统配置,如增加CPU分配策略、优化内存管理等,以提高服务器的资源利用率和性能。
负载均衡:通过负载均衡技术,将请求分散到多台服务器上,降低单台服务器的负载压力。
服务器CPU跑高是一个需要引起高度重视的问题。通过识别原因、分析影响并采取有效的优化策略,我们可以有效地降低CPU使用率,提高服务器的性能和稳定性。在未来的运维工作中,我们应持续关注服务器的性能指标,及时发现并解决问题,确保服务的顺畅运行。
下一篇
网络安全必备:如何发现和修复互联网漏洞?
随着互联网技术的不断发展和普及,网络安全问题已经成为大家关注的焦点。因为网络泄露、黑客攻击、恶意软件等问题,很多人和企业都遭受了损失。想要保护自己的网络安全,关键在于发现和修复互联网漏洞。那么,本文将带大家详细了解网络安全必备:如何发现和修复互联网漏洞?一、什么是互联网漏洞?互联网漏洞是指在互联网上存在的安全缺陷,是黑客攻击网站或者系统的“门户”。这些漏洞可能来自于操作系统、应用程序、网站设计、用户密码等多个方面。一旦黑客利用漏洞入侵了系统,他们就可以获取敏感数据、日志、密码、金融信息,甚至破坏或篡改系统。二、如何发现互联网漏洞?漏洞扫描工具漏洞扫描工具是自动化的软件,用于识别系统中的安全漏洞。扫描工具可以立即检索网络服务的任何已知漏洞,并报告它们的位置和详细信息。可用的扫描技术包括不断增加的端口扫描、服务扫描、弱口令扫描、漏洞扫描等。一般使用漏洞扫描工具的流程如下:(1)扫描设备IP。(2)端口扫描。(3)服务检测。(4)弱口令检测。(5)漏洞检测和扫描。漏洞挖掘技术漏洞挖掘是一种人工发现漏洞的方法,是白帽子常用的技术。挖掘漏洞的方法是在目标系统上进行手动测试,总结出攻击的漏洞情况。漏洞挖掘的流程如下:(1)了解目标系统。(2)系统扫描和收集。(3)弱口令检测。(4)手动挖掘漏洞。三、如何修复互联网漏洞?及时升级补丁常见网络攻击手段就是利用网络系统和软件的漏洞。因此及时升级系统和软件的安全补丁是很重要的。升级补丁可以修复已知的漏洞,提高系统和应用程序的安全。保证与网络处于同一级别的所有设备在维护方面都是最新的。通过安装补丁和更新安全文件夹,可以保障系统的安全。强化密码保护强密码可以减少对黑客攻击的风险。密码使用应遵循以下原则:(1)密码复杂性:应包含数字、字母大小写和特殊字符。(2)密码长度:长度应达到8个或更多字符。(3)差异性:不同的网站和应用使用不同的密码。(4)定期更改密码:密码应定期更改。定期备份数据定期备份数据不仅可以防止数据损失,还可以帮助我们及时修复互联网漏洞。当我们发现安全漏洞和攻击已经发生时,备份的数据可以在短时间内恢复到正常的状态,避免有重要数据丢失。恢复系统默认设置为了避免网络漏洞,拥有网络和系统的管理员应该恢复系统的默认设置。整个操作应该包括:(1)检查系统文件和组件,找出问题和修复错误。(2)检查安装的应用程序和所有组件,并根据版本和代码来升级软件。(3)安装本地防火墙和杀毒软件,以确保始终保持安全。四、重视互联网漏洞防范需要我们采取多种手段,除了上文提到的方法外,我们还可以通过安全升级、数据加密和访问权限等方式加强网络安全。建立合理的安全机制和安全意识,保护自己的互联网安全是我们必须重视的任务。
虚拟化技术是什么?
虚拟化技术是一种资源管理技术,它将计算机的各种实体资源,如服务器、网络、内存及存储等,予以抽象、转换后呈现出来,并可供分割、组合为一个或多个电脑配置环境。虚拟化技术可以模拟真正的(或者称物理的)计算机资源,从而打破实体结构间的不可切割的障碍,使用户可以比原本的组态更好的方式来应用这些资源。这些资源的新虚拟部分是不受现有资源的架设方式、地域或物理组态所限制。 虚拟化技术的分类主要包括网络虚拟化和存储虚拟化。网络虚拟化将网络资源进行整合,将硬件与软件的网络设备资源,以及网络功能整合为一个统一的、基于软件可管理的虚拟网络。存储虚拟化则整合所有存储资源为一个存储池,对外提供逻辑存储接口,用户通过逻辑接口进行数据的读写,不论有多少个硬件存储设备,对外看到的只有一个。 虚拟化技术的主要优势在于提高计算机的工作效率,解决高性能的物理硬件产能过剩和老的旧的硬件产能过低的重组重用问题,并最大化地利用物理硬件。虚拟化技术已经成为私有云和混合云设计方案的基础,通过虚拟机(Virtual Machine, VM)技术,可以在一台计算机上同时运行多个逻辑计算机,每个逻辑计算机可运行不同的操作系统,并且应用程序都可以在相互独立的空间内运行而互不影响。 总的来说,虚拟化技术是一种重要的计算机技术,它可以提高计算机的工作效率,优化硬件资源的利用,为云计算和大数据等技术的发展提供了重要的支持。
负载均衡是什么?
均衡负载(Load Balancing)是一种集群技术,主要用于在多个计算机(计算机集群)、网络连接、CPU、磁盘驱动器或其他资源中分配负载,以达到最优化资源使用、最大化吞吐率、最小化响应时间、同时避免过载的目的。 均衡负载的核心思想是将负载(工作任务)进行平衡、分摊到多个操作单元上进行运行,如Web服务器、FTP服务器、企业核心应用服务器和其他主要任务服务器等,从而协同完成工作任务。它建立在现有网络结构之上,提供了一种廉价有效透明的方法扩展服务器和网络设备的带宽、加强网络数据处理能力、增加吞吐量、提高网络的可用性和灵活性。 均衡负载的原理是通过运行在前面的负载均衡服务,按照指定的负载均衡算法,将流量分配到后端服务集群上,从而为系统提供并行扩展的能力。这种技术允许将大量并发访问或数据流量分担到多台节点设备上分别处理,减少用户等待响应的时间;同时,单个重负载的运算可以分担到多台节点设备上做并行处理,每个节点设备处理结束后,将结果汇总,返回给用户,系统处理能力得到大幅度提高。 常见的负载均衡算法包括轮询法(Round Robin, RR)、加权轮询法(Weighted Round Robin, WRR)、源地址散列法(Source Hash)、最小连接数法(Least Connections)等。每种算法都有其特定的适用场景和优缺点。 均衡负载是现代计算机系统中不可或缺的一部分,它通过对负载的合理分配,实现了系统资源的最大化利用,提高了系统的可靠性、可用性和扩展性。
查看更多文章 >